The first name David has its origins in the Hebrew name "Dawid," which means "beloved." It is deeply rooted in biblical history, notably associated with King David of Israel, a central figure in Jewish, Christian, and Islamic traditions, who is celebrated for his leadership and poetic contributions, including the Psalms. The name first appeared in ancient Israel and has since spread across various cultures and regions, becoming particularly popular in Christian contexts due to its biblical significance. Variations of the name include the Spanish "David," the French "David," the Italian "Davide," and the Russian "Davit," among others, with slight differences in pronunciation and spelling. The name has consistently been associated with qualities such as strength, leadership, and artistry, reflecting the characteristics of its most famous bearer. David remains a widely used name across the globe, symbolizing a rich historical and cultural legacy.
The last name Hagberg has Scandinavian origins, particularly from Sweden, where it is derived from the Old Norse elements "hagi," meaning "enclosure" or "pasture," and "berg," meaning "mountain" or "hill." This suggests that the name may have originally referred to someone who lived near a hill or a pasture, indicating a geographical feature of the landscape. Historically, surnames like Hagberg were often associated with the characteristics of the land or the occupations of those who lived there, possibly indicating a connection to farming or pastoral life. Variations of the name can be found in different regions, including Hagberg in Sweden and Hagbergh in some areas, reflecting regional dialects and linguistic changes. The name may also appear in different forms in other Scandinavian countries, though it remains relatively consistent in spelling. Overall, Hagberg is a name that encapsulates a connection to the natural landscape and the agrarian lifestyle of its early bearers.
